The global market for ICT and FCT Test Equipment was estimated to be worth US$ 541 million in 2024 and is forecast to a readjusted size of US$ 772 million by 2031 with a CAGR of 5.1% during the forecast period 2025-2031.

In-Circuit Tester is an equipment for printed circuit board test. Using a bed of nails in-circuit test equipment it is possible gain access to the circuit nodes on a board and measure the performance of the components regardless of the other components connected to them. PCB functional testing is the most comprehensive testing regimen for determining whether a manufactured board can leave the factory and be shipped to the customer. The goal is to identify manufacturing defects that affect reliability, missing or incorrect components, and opens/shorts in nets or solder connections.
Rapid growth in consumer electronics, communication devices, automotive electronics, industrial automation, and medical electronics has increased the complexity of circuit boards and finished products, creating a strong need for high-precision, high-efficiency testing equipment. Strict quality control standards and reliability requirements encourage manufacturers to adopt ICT and FCT solutions to reduce rework and minimize product failures. Additionally, faster product life cycles, the adoption of automated production, and the rise of smart manufacturing are further boosting the demand for automated testing equipment. Overall, electronics industry growth, increasing product complexity, higher quality control standards, and the trend toward automation and smart manufacturing are the key factors driving the ICT and FCT tester market.
The global key manufacturers of In-Circuit Testers & Functional Testers include Keysight, Teradyne, TRI, Hioki, SPEA, Digitaltest, Okano, ADSYS Technologies, and PTI, etc. In 2024, the global top five players had a share approximately 65% in terms of revenue.

ICT and FCT test equipments are equipments used for testing in electronics manufacturing. The ICT test equipment is used to perform in-circuit testing, mainly to detect faults or wrong connections on circuit boards. It contacts the test points on the circuit board through the pin or bed of needles to perform signal test, continuity test and component parameter test to determine whether the function and soldering in the circuit board are correct. The ICT test equipment usually includes test machine tools, test fixtures and control software. The FCT test equipment is used for functional testing, mainly to verify the functional performance of electronic products in the actual use environment. It conducts a comprehensive functional test of the product by simulating real workloads and input signals to confirm whether the product meets the specification requirements. The FCT test equipment usually includes test instruments, test software and test fixtures.
